Osmond unfortunately couldn't capitalize on their home-court advantage in their season opener. They lost 3-0 to the Wynot Blue Devils on Thursday. The Tigers have struggled against the Blue Devils recently, as the game was their fifth consecutive lost matchup.
Osmond may have fallen short, but they were sure consistent: they scored 11 points in every single set they played. The match finished with set scores of 25-11, 25-11, 25-11.
Multiple players turned in solid performances to lead Wynot to victory, but perhaps none more so than Kenna Oligmueller, who had 11 kills, seven digs, and five aces. That's the most aces Oligmueller has posted since back in October of 2024. The team also got some help courtesy of Jordan Foxhoven, who had nine kills, eight digs, and four aces.
Coming up, Osmond will head out on the road to take on Creighton on Tuesday. As for Wynot, they will take on Boyd County on Tuesday.
